1 . Precisely what is the Quartz value idea to plumbers? What is Aqualisa Quartz benefit proposition to consumers? The worthiness proposition of Aqualisa Quartz to plumbers is that it is easy to install, it can be more profitable because they are capable of do more installations. For the reason that installation method is less complicated, it takes a fraction of the time to install (only half a time compared to a couple of days previously).

This gives plumbers the opportunity to set up more products and record some of the traditional 6-month ready list to get plumbing jobs.

Due to a less complex installation method, even apprentices are able to do installs, instead of just certified plumbers. The Aqualisa Quartz product also provides excellent outcomes, which gives the plumbers improved credibility with consumers pertaining to installing an exceptional product with less does not work properly. The value task of Aqualisa Quartz to consumers is the fact it had useful and reliable water pressure and temp. It is dependable for kids and elderly people. Very low one touch control with a red mild indicator which usually allowed consumers to know if the water reaches the desired heat.

Once the temperatures is set, consumers only need to drive the one contact control and wait for the mild. It is easier to install intended for the DO IT YOURSELF sector of shoppers since it would not require excavation of the wall to reach domestic plumbing. The Aqualisa Quartz has excellent style and appearance. The control box could now be put into any space close to a water source and power outlet ” even in out of sight spots. 2 . Why is the Quartz shower certainly not selling? Product sales of the Quartz shower are significantly below expectations. There are many contributing elements. Slow Adoption Processes.

Many plumbers are wary of new-technology and do not trust it, specially in light of previous electric control failures. In addition , plumbers establish a enthusiasm with a particular brand and see changing their very own preferred product as an unnecessary cost. The uncertainty of the performance, which might result in having to do fix work, as well as the time to a new new product, is viewed as a barrier. They apparently adhere to the rule, “If it ain’t broke, may fix it. inches Although there is not much adoption with the item, plumbers can also pose any challenge together with the structure of their fee chedule. If a labor cost of 45 to 85 pounds per hour was decreased by 73% because of the ease of installation, a local plumber may have to routine almost 3 times as many shower room jobs to make up the potential loss in labor income or use the time to deliver other companies. Sales Targeting and Cannibalization. With the sales team spending 90% of their time upon existing accounts, there is inadequate focus on transact shops , which concentrate on plumbers. Additionally, it creates the threat of cannibalization of some other product lines.

Typically, new products needs to be introduced to existing customers to either catch new revenue or exchange aging items. Another strategy is to expose the products to new customers. In this instance, the product postures direct competition and the sales force seems uncertain of how to proceed when adding the Quartz to their typical revenue process. The solution is for businesses to refocus the sales team to target new clients or part a portion with the sales force to specialize in a particular product line. Item Testing vs . Market Research.

The study and advancement team in Aqualisa appear to do a good-job of obtaining feedback from your users also to determine what tends to make the best end user experience. Yet , there would not appear to be any kind of feedback collected from its main customer base upon what challenges they are facing, how the brand new product may well solve them, and eventually how it may benefit the plumbers. The approach takes on plumbers will catch about because it was simply a better shower. Yet , that is not the existing situation. a few. Aqualisa spent three years and 5. eight million growing the Quartz. Was the merchandise worth the investment?

Is usually Quartz a niche product or a mainstream product? The Quartz line method worth the time and cash that Aqualisa spent developing it. The business has been capable of create an innovative, break-through item in an really mature industry. Given the current pricing style, Aqualisa may break even on its purchase by selling slightly over 18, 700 units (assuming a 50/50 divided between the two models offered). There were 550, 000 electrical power shower course units bought from the United Kingdom in 2000, so selling merely fewer than twenty, 000 of this superior merchandise should be an achievable goal.

The Quartz is a mainstream product that appeals to anyone that can afford it. While the Quartz may have failed to content strong primary sales quantities there is clearly a demand in the United Kingdom (and most likely the rest of Europe) for a product that treatments all of the challenges associated with the aged plumbing system that is available in this portion of the world. The moment there is good demand and later one distributor that sufficiently addresses each of the consumer requirements the only absent ingredient is known as a proper marketing strategy, which is evidently lacking.

If perhaps Aqualisa can effectively communicate the benefits of the Quartz products to the two plumbers and consumers properly there is no purpose Quartz are unable to fuel Aqualisa’s growth for several years. four. Aqualisa at present has three brands: Aqualisa, Gainsborough, and ShowerMax. Precisely what is the rationale behind this multiple brand approach? Does it make sense? The action of managing multiple brands is a skinny tight string walk which can help elevate a brand yet almost just as quickly diminish it. Aqualisa has recognized distinct markets within the overall marketplace of tub areas.

An excellent example of multiple brands can be drawn from the quick anecdote at the outset of the newspaper with the mentioning of the Marriott that Mr. Rawlinson was obviously a guest of. Marriot has a multitude of brands within their manufacturer. Consumers appear in any every form, from those who seek out quality 1st and have the ways to pay the price of the best to prospects who look at the price tag initially and bargain on top quality and everywhere in between. Marriott consists of the Courtyard, The Fairfield Inn, Marriott Resorts, and Residence Inn, in order to name a few.

The target is to separate the demands and requirements of specific types of consumers and employ each company to focus and focus on that form of consumer. They may have broken down their very own branding in to an architecture defining the brands categories as, famous luxury, luxurious, lifestyle, personal unsecured, modern essentials, extended stay and destination entertainment. More than just creating these types of branches they may have focused on clearly establishing another identity for each and every brand while still embodying the overall total brand’s mission.

This is a horrible juggling action in multiple brand management, teetering to find the perfect balance between splitting up and concentration. The expanded stay category consists of these rooms including kitchens, and also other amenities to cater more too long term guests by way of example. Any marketplace is filled with a myriad of different consumers so to generalize them with one brand being a ‘one size fits all’ service will be foolish. Marriott has put in a great amount of advertising and marketing dollars and effort to research the market and gain insight into the demands of the buyer.

This has already been accomplished by various pricing points, among elements, in order to break up the target marketplace into multiple targets. This allows the brand to higher serve each demographics certain needs more efficiently and effectively. Aqualisa acknowledges the same craze within the shower room market. As stated in the case analyze, the United Kingdom’s purchasers tend to get into three charges segments: high quality, standard, and value. Aqualisa has developed three brands correspondingly: Aquastyle, Gainsborough, and ShowerMax, to permeate these marketplaces.

Not only will be consumers focused on price although also simplicity of use, installation and satisfaction. These several factors convert to different types of owners. They incorporate the DO-IT-YOURSELF consumers, plumbers, developers and contractors, as well as the retail customer. These various users every single need to be reached through unique means. Tradeshows are the best location to reach plumbers and programmers while choices like components stores and showrooms are best for DIY and retail customers.

In a market such as the bathtub market in britain, there must be several methods and tactics of marketplace penetration. To be able to best serve these different strategies, Aqualisa must customise and tailor a product line designed for each market part. This model is a essential instance where multiple branding is the best choice. Just producing one company in this case would most definitely pigeon-hole their operation and typecast them while just like a product pertaining to only one or two types of consumers.

A singular brand could in turn ostracize the needs of other various types of demand inside the market. The sheer reality there are industrial and residential applications support the fact that multiple item brands are essential. Promoting a universal concept and well suited for your brands that involves all catalog and bridges their differences is imperative, Aqualisa provides chosen an intelligent strategy in pursuing multiple brands. five. What will need to Rawlinson carry out to generate revenue momentum to get the Quartz product?

Will need to he change his online strategy to target buyers directly, focus on the DO-IT-YOURSELF market, or target builders? Should this individual lower the price tag on the Quartz? Or should certainly he do something differently altogether? Even though the Quartz is truly ground breaking and innovative when it comes to function and design, many consumers and industry experts alike are not fully mindful of its features and benefits. Aqualisa will need to commit to a great aggressive promoting campaign targeted towards the buyer and DIY markets correspondingly.

Targeting consumers directly will increase brand reputation, provide product differentiation, and in turn allow customers to make educated decisions. Armed with information coming from customized advertising and marketing strategies, customers are in a unique situation to reduce the leverage plumbers have customarily had in selecting assembly brands. The cost point for the Quartz should not be reduced because it is a fresh revolutionary item with essentially no market competition.

Yet , Aqualisa will need to develop techniques to effectively mitigate the immediate and continuing impact of cannibalization as they make an effort to increase Quartz’s sales. Aqualisa could also reap the benefits of developing a marketing scheme to target plumbers and or industry specialists. Plumbers happen to be influencing 73% of all showering purchase decisions, so receiving there buy-in is crucial. In addition , the overall life time value of the single local plumber could be very well into the hundreds and hundreds of euros (where as the lifetime benefit of a customer is a couple of hundred).

The organization acknowledges the challenges it faces with products boasting technological breakthroughs due to industry skepticism. This kind of reluctance offers undoubtedly been responsible for the lack luster demand as proved by merchandise availability within trade outlets. As part of this plan the company could offer a series of training courses, trade, or industry reveals designed solely for plumbers to showcase the Quartz features, dependability, and set up ease. When it comes to distribution, Aqualisa needs to start a better task of getting their products into the market.

Aqualisa at present has simply a forty percent presence in trade outlets and 25% in demonstrate rooms. In order to truly really make a difference in revenue, the product must be available in more outlets for purchasing. Distribution has to be expanded. Together with the aforementioned tactics, an increased existence is needed in trade outlets, show bedrooms, DIY stores and basic consumer stores to increase manufacturer awareness and recognition. A reduced pricing structure will not be a good strategy for the long run because it will reduce earnings margin.

There is some place to lower the buying price of the Quartz to match the profit margins on the other Aqualisa products. Currently the Quartz line is definitely close to a 32% earnings margin, in comparison to the other Aqualisa products including 22% to 32%. Virtually all products fall near 26%. However , reducing the price can be a viable alternative in the future after sales volumes possess increased significantly.
